How Poverty Affects Brain Development By Olivia Rose On Prezi Building on a robust body of literature in the behavioral sciences, developmental neuroscientists have begun to investigate whether tangible effects of poverty and adversity can be detected in the structure and function of the developing brain. These mediating factors may lead to various heterogenous effects at the brain level (e.g. differences in brain structure and function, differences in brain volume, etc.), which in turn can lead to negative outcomes often associated with low ses (e.g. low iq) and can lead to resilience. In this article, we, for the first time, provide a comprehensive overview and unified framework of the impact of poverty and low socioeconomic status (ses) on the brain and behaviour. Growing up in poverty is one of the most powerful predictors of cognitive development. children from low income families score, on average, 12 18 iq points lower than children from affluent families — a gap that emerges before age 2 and, without intervention, persists through adulthood.
